[Talk-us] Whole-US Garmin Map update - 2019-02-10
These are based off of Lambertus's work here: http://garmin.openstreetmap.nl If you have questions or comments about these maps, please feel free to ask. However, please do not send me private mail. The odds are, someone else will have the same questions, and by asking on the talk-us@ list, others can benefit. Downloads: http://daveh.dev.openstreetmap.org/garmin/Lambertus/2019-02-10 Map to visualize what each file contains: http://daveh.dev.openstreetmap.org/garmin/Lambertus/2019-02-10/kml/kml.html FAQ Why did you do this? I wrote scripts to joined them myself to lessen the impact of doing a large join on Lambertus's server. I've also cut them in large longitude swaths that should fit conveniently on removable media. http://daveh.dev.openstreetmap.org/garmin/Lambertus/2019-02-10 Can or should I seed the torrents? Yes!! If you use the .torrent files, please seed. That web server is in the UK, and it helps to have some peers on this side of the Atlantic. Why is my map missing small rectangular areas? There have been some missing tiles from Lambertus's map (the red rectangles), I don't see any at the moment, so you may want to update if you had issues with the last set. Why can I not copy the large files to my new SD card? If you buy a new card (especially SDHC), some are FAT16 from the factory. I had to reformat it to let me create a >2GB file. Does your map cover Mexico/Canada? Yes!! I have, for the purposes of this map, annexed Ontario in to the USA. Some areas of North America that are close to the US also just happen to get pulled in to these maps. [Talk-us] Mapathon Results - Spartanburg SC
Hi, We had a mapathon coordinated by https://tasks.openstreetmap.us/project/76 to visually inspect all roads and update them from GIS data as appropriate. Much of the GIS data was newer and there were many road name corrections (names or Road -> Avenue, Drive -> Street, etc). In addition there were many residential cases of single>dual carriageway or dual>single, blocked streets, etc. Some of the GIS road data was out of date or incorrect - we may try to feed it back to them if we can find a contact who has the time. In any case, more automated conflation techniques can now be applied to that area for more focused updates since the roads conform to reality.
